ConsoleLoggerProvider Конструкторы
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
ConsoleLoggerProvider(IConsoleLoggerSettings) |
Является устаревшей.
|
ConsoleLoggerProvider(IOptionsMonitor<ConsoleLoggerOptions>) |
Создает экземпляр класса ConsoleLoggerProvider. |
ConsoleLoggerProvider(IOptionsMonitor<ConsoleLoggerOptions>, IEnumerable<ConsoleFormatter>) |
Создает экземпляр класса ConsoleLoggerProvider. |
ConsoleLoggerProvider(Func<String,LogLevel,Boolean>, Boolean) |
Является устаревшей.
|
ConsoleLoggerProvider(Func<String,LogLevel,Boolean>, Boolean, Boolean) |
Является устаревшей.
|
ConsoleLoggerProvider(IConsoleLoggerSettings)
Внимание!
This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options
public:
ConsoleLoggerProvider(Microsoft::Extensions::Logging::Console::IConsoleLoggerSettings ^ settings);
public ConsoleLoggerProvider (Microsoft.Extensions.Logging.Console.IConsoleLoggerSettings settings);
[System.Obsolete("This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options")]
public ConsoleLoggerProvider (Microsoft.Extensions.Logging.Console.IConsoleLoggerSettings settings);
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Microsoft.Extensions.Logging.Console.IConsoleLoggerSettings -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
[<System.Obsolete("This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options")>]
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Microsoft.Extensions.Logging.Console.IConsoleLoggerSettings -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
Public Sub New (settings As IConsoleLoggerSettings)
Параметры
- settings
- IConsoleLoggerSettings
- Атрибуты
Применяется к
ConsoleLoggerProvider(IOptionsMonitor<ConsoleLoggerOptions>)
Создает экземпляр класса ConsoleLoggerProvider.
public:
ConsoleLoggerProvider(Microsoft::Extensions::Options::IOptionsMonitor<Microsoft::Extensions::Logging::Console::ConsoleLoggerOptions ^> ^ options);
public ConsoleLoggerProvider (Microsoft.Extensions.Options.IOptionsMonitor<Microsoft.Extensions.Logging.Console.ConsoleLoggerOptions> options);
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Microsoft.Extensions.Options.IOptionsMonitor<Microsoft.Extensions.Logging.Console.ConsoleLoggerOptions> -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
Public Sub New (options As IOptionsMonitor(Of ConsoleLoggerOptions))
Параметры
- options
- IOptionsMonitor<ConsoleLoggerOptions>
Параметры, с которыми необходимо создать экземпляры ConsoleLogger.
Применяется к
ConsoleLoggerProvider(IOptionsMonitor<ConsoleLoggerOptions>, IEnumerable<ConsoleFormatter>)
Создает экземпляр класса ConsoleLoggerProvider.
public:
ConsoleLoggerProvider(Microsoft::Extensions::Options::IOptionsMonitor<Microsoft::Extensions::Logging::Console::ConsoleLoggerOptions ^> ^ options, System::Collections::Generic::IEnumerable<Microsoft::Extensions::Logging::Console::ConsoleFormatter ^> ^ formatters);
public ConsoleLoggerProvider (Microsoft.Extensions.Options.IOptionsMonitor<Microsoft.Extensions.Logging.Console.ConsoleLoggerOptions> options, System.Collections.Generic.IEnumerable<Microsoft.Extensions.Logging.Console.ConsoleFormatter> formatters);
public ConsoleLoggerProvider (Microsoft.Extensions.Options.IOptionsMonitor<Microsoft.Extensions.Logging.Console.ConsoleLoggerOptions> options, System.Collections.Generic.IEnumerable<Microsoft.Extensions.Logging.Console.ConsoleFormatter>? formatters);
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Microsoft.Extensions.Options.IOptionsMonitor<Microsoft.Extensions.Logging.Console.ConsoleLoggerOptions> * seq<Microsoft.Extensions.Logging.Console.ConsoleFormatter> -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
Public Sub New (options As IOptionsMonitor(Of ConsoleLoggerOptions), formatters As IEnumerable(Of ConsoleFormatter))
Параметры
- options
- IOptionsMonitor<ConsoleLoggerOptions>
Параметры, с которыми необходимо создать экземпляры ConsoleLogger.
- formatters
- IEnumerable<ConsoleFormatter>
Модули форматирования журнала, добавленные для экземпляров ConsoleLogger.
Применяется к
ConsoleLoggerProvider(Func<String,LogLevel,Boolean>, Boolean)
Внимание!
This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options.
public:
ConsoleLoggerProvider(Func<System::String ^, Microsoft::Extensions::Logging::LogLevel, bool> ^ filter, bool includeScopes);
public ConsoleLoggerProvider (Func<string,Microsoft.Extensions.Logging.LogLevel,bool> filter, bool includeScopes);
[System.Obsolete("This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options.")]
public ConsoleLoggerProvider (Func<string,Microsoft.Extensions.Logging.LogLevel,bool> filter, bool includeScopes);
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Func<string, Microsoft.Extensions.Logging.LogLevel, bool> * bool -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
[<System.Obsolete("This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options.")>]
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Func<string, Microsoft.Extensions.Logging.LogLevel, bool> * bool -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
Public Sub New (filter As Func(Of String, LogLevel, Boolean), includeScopes As Boolean)
Параметры
- includeScopes
- Boolean
- Атрибуты
Применяется к
ConsoleLoggerProvider(Func<String,LogLevel,Boolean>, Boolean, Boolean)
Внимание!
This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options.
public:
ConsoleLoggerProvider(Func<System::String ^, Microsoft::Extensions::Logging::LogLevel, bool> ^ filter, bool includeScopes, bool disableColors);
public ConsoleLoggerProvider (Func<string,Microsoft.Extensions.Logging.LogLevel,bool> filter, bool includeScopes, bool disableColors);
[System.Obsolete("This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options.")]
public ConsoleLoggerProvider (Func<string,Microsoft.Extensions.Logging.LogLevel,bool> filter, bool includeScopes, bool disableColors);
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Func<string, Microsoft.Extensions.Logging.LogLevel, bool> * bool * bool -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
[<System.Obsolete("This method is obsolete and will be removed in a future version. The recommended alternative is using LoggerFactory to configure filtering and ConsoleLoggerOptions to configure logging options.")>]
new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ider : Func<string, Microsoft.Extensions.Logging.LogLevel, bool> * bool * bool -> Microsoft.Extensions.Logging.Console.ConsoleLoggerProvider
Public Sub New (filter As Func(Of String, LogLevel, Boolean), includeScopes As Boolean, disableColors As Boolean)
Параметры
- includeScopes
- Boolean
- disableColors
- Boolean
- Атрибуты